    Samsung stock has lost roughly 38% from its June record high while the company was printing the largest quarterly operating profit in technology history. That gap between the earnings and the tape is the whole story, and it is not resolved yet.

    Samsung Electronics (KRX: 005930) traded around ₩231,000 in the August 6–7, 2026 sessions, against an intraday record of ₩374,500 set on June 19, 2026. The stock is still up sharply over twelve months — the 52-week range runs from ₩67,500 to ₩374,500 — but anyone who bought the AI-memory story in June is now sitting on a large loss. What follows is the drawdown in numbers, why it happened, what the valuation actually implies, and how traders are getting exposure without a Korean brokerage account.

    Samsung Stock Price Now: The August 6 Selloff in Numbers

    The most violent day was August 6, 2026. Samsung fell 5.69% to ₩231,500 as the KOSPI dropped 4.37% and triggered a sidecar suspension. SK Hynix fell 8.27% to ₩1.53 million in the same session. The proximate trigger came from the US overnight: SanDisk guided fiscal Q1 2027 revenue to a midpoint near $10.55 billion against roughly $10.8 billion expected, and the resulting selloff in Western Digital and its peers spilled straight into Asian memory names.

    Here is the drawdown mapped against the news that caused it.

    Date (2026)What happened005930 levelFrom the June peak
    Jun 19Intraday record high on AI-memory demand₩374,500—
    Jul 7–8Preliminary Q2 record profit; shares fall anyway~₩318,000−15%
    Jul 30Full Q2 results fail to lift the market——
    Aug 6SanDisk guidance miss; KOSPI −4.37%, sidecar triggered₩231,500−38%
    Aug 6–7Stock stabilises near the lows~₩231,000−38%

    Sources: Korea Exchange market data and company disclosures, as of August 7, 2026. Market capitalisation stood near ₩1,470 trillion with a dividend yield of about 0.65%.

    The earnings context makes the move stranger. Samsung's preliminary Q2 2026 figures showed operating profit of roughly ₩89.4 trillion on revenue near ₩171 trillion — around a 19-fold increase year over year, and on those numbers the highest quarterly operating profit any technology company has reported. The stock has fallen 38% since the quarter that produced it.

    Why Samsung Stock Fell 38% From Its June Record High

    Three things happened at once, and only one of them is about Samsung.

    The good news was already in the price. The stock rose more than 190% over twelve months into the June peak. When a company delivers a 19-fold profit increase, the question immediately becomes what it does for an encore. A beat becomes an exit, not an entry.

    Leverage unwound. Korean retail investors financed a meaningful share of the semiconductor rally on margin. When prices fell, brokers force-closed losing positions, which pushed prices lower, which forced more closes. Samsung fell as much as 14% intraday during one leg of that unwind before recovering to close down about 5%. This is the part of the decline with no fundamental content — it is plumbing.

    The cycle question got louder. Samsung, SK Hynix and Micron are all expanding capacity at the same time. KB Securities models DRAM prices up 148% year over year in 2026 and NAND up 111%, with supply staying tight into 2027 and new capacity arriving in volume around 2028. The bear case is not that demand disappears; it is that the industry solves its own shortage on schedule, and memory has never once ended a boom gently.

    The more useful framing: Samsung is no longer a diversified electronics conglomerate in the market's eyes. It is a levered claim on DRAM and HBM pricing that happens to also sell phones. That is why a US flash-memory company's guidance can knock 5% off a Korean stock in one session.

    Is Samsung Stock Cheap at 3.5x Forward Earnings?

    After the drawdown, Goldman Sachs and JPMorgan both kept buy ratings, noting that forward P/E ratios of roughly 3.5x–3.6x look detached from fundamentals. On 2026 operating profit estimates that have been lifted toward ₩220 trillion, that multiple is real arithmetic, not a typo.

    It is also exactly what a peak-cycle semiconductor stock is supposed to look like. Memory names trade at their lowest multiples when earnings are highest, because the market is discounting the earnings coming down, not going up. A 3.5x forward P/E is a signal that the market assigns low confidence to the E, not that the P is a bargain. The honest version of the bull case is not "it is cheap" — it is "the market is discounting a cycle turn that arrives later, or milder, than consensus assumes."

    Samsung Stock Price Targets Range From ₩210,000 to ₩725,000

    The analyst dispersion is the most revealing dataset on this stock right now. The consensus 12-month target sits near ₩468,000, but the range behind that average is extraordinary.

    EstimateLevelImplied vs ~₩231,000
    Street high₩725,000+214%
    Frequently cited high target₩480,000+108%
    Mean 12-month target~₩468,000+103%
    Street low₩210,000−9%

    Sources: aggregated sell-side 12-month targets as of August 2026.

    A 3.5x spread between the highest and lowest target on a $1 trillion-class company is not normal, and it should be read as a warning rather than an opportunity. It means the analyst community has no shared view on when the memory cycle peaks. Anyone quoting the ₩468,000 mean as a forecast is quoting the midpoint of a genuine disagreement. Note also that the low target sits below the current price — a real analyst somewhere thinks this is still not the bottom.

    How to Trade Samsung Stock With USDT on WEEX

    Samsung's ordinary shares sit on the Korea Exchange with no US listing and no standard ADR, which is why access is the single most common obstacle for overseas buyers. The conventional routes — an international broker with KRX access, the London and Luxembourg GDRs (SMSN, SMSEL), or the thin US OTC line SSNLF — are covered in detail in WEEX's guide to how to buy Samsung stock from outside Korea.

    The crypto-native route is a USDT-margined perpetual. WEEX lists a SAMSUNG-USDT perpetual contract that tracks the share price and trades continuously, including while the Korea Exchange is closed.

    SAMSUNG-USDT perpetualDetail (as of August 10, 2026)
    ContractSAMSUNGUSDT, USDT-margined perpetual
    Last price165.07 USDT
    Max leverageUp to 50×
    Trading hours24/7, including KRX holidays and weekends
    SettlementUSDT; funding paid periodically
    What you ownPrice exposure only — no shares, no dividend, no vote

    One detail worth doing the arithmetic on: at 165.07 USDT against a ₩231,000 share price, the contract is priced off an implied KRW/USD rate of roughly 1,399. That means a USDT-margined position carries two exposures, not one. If the won weakens against the dollar while the Korean share price is flat, the dollar-quoted contract falls — and traders who only watched the KRX chart will not understand why their position moved. This is the most common avoidable mistake on foreign-listed perpetuals.

    Two more cautions. A perpetual is a derivative, not equity: WEEX's explainer on how tokenized stocks and their custody models work sets out where economic exposure ends and legal ownership begins. And 50× leverage on an asset that has moved 5–8% in single sessions this month is a liquidation event waiting for a date — the August 6 intraday low was roughly 14% below the prior close, which wipes out anything above about 7× with no stop.

    What Comes Next for Samsung Stock

    The near-term catalysts are specific and dated: quarterly DRAM and HBM contract pricing, Samsung's HBM4 qualification progress with Nvidia, and any guidance revision on second-half memory pricing. None of them are about the phone business.

    For traders, the practical read is that Samsung stock now behaves like a high-beta cyclical with a mega-cap's market capitalisation. It fell 38% in seven weeks while its fundamentals set records, which tells you that positioning and cycle expectations — not earnings — are setting the price. Size positions for that, whether you are holding GDRs or a leveraged perpetual.

    FAQ

    1. Why is Samsung stock down if profits hit a record?

    The market had already priced in a strong quarter and moved on to the next one. A leveraged retail unwind forced additional selling, and a guidance miss at SanDisk on August 6, 2026 revived concerns that the memory cycle peaks in 2027 as new capacity arrives.

    2. How far has Samsung stock fallen from its high?

    About 38%, from an intraday record of ₩374,500 on June 19, 2026 to roughly ₩231,000 in the August 6–7 sessions.

    3. What is the ticker for Samsung stock?

    The primary listing is 005930 on the Korea Exchange. The US OTC line is SSNLF, and the GDRs trade as SMSN in London and SMSEL in Luxembourg. There is no standard US ADR.

    4. Is Samsung stock cheap at a 3.5x forward P/E?

    That multiple reflects peak-cycle earnings, which is normal for memory stocks at a top. A low forward P/E here signals doubt about the earnings estimate rather than an obvious discount, and analyst targets range from ₩210,000 to ₩725,000 — a genuine disagreement, not a consensus buy.

    5. Can I trade Samsung stock with crypto?

    WEEX lists a USDT-margined SAMSUNG-USDT perpetual that trades 24/7 with up to 50× leverage. It gives price exposure only — no share ownership, dividends or voting rights — and availability varies by region.

    6. Does the USDT perpetual carry currency risk?

    Yes. The contract is dollar-quoted against a won-denominated share price, so won weakness reduces the contract price even if the KRX quote is unchanged.
